Decoding Diamond Machine Types and Their Costs
First things first: Diamond machines aren't one-size-fits-all. They come in various shapes and sizes, each designed for specific tasks. Understanding these different types is crucial for figuring out the price. Let's break down some of the most common ones and their general cost ranges.
Polishing Machines
Polishing machines are the workhorses of the diamond industry. They're used to refine the surface of diamonds, giving them that dazzling shine we all love. The price of a polishing machine can vary wildly, depending on its features and capacity. Basic, manual polishing machines might start around a few thousand dollars, perfect for smaller operations or beginners. These machines usually require more manual labor but offer a more affordable entry point. As you move up the scale, you'll find automated polishing machines that can cost upwards of $50,000 or even $100,000+. These high-tech machines are designed for high-volume production, incorporating features like robotic arms, advanced polishing heads, and sophisticated control systems. This investment allows for more accuracy and efficiency in the polishing process. The main factors affecting polishing machine prices are the number of polishing heads, automation level, precision, and the materials used in construction. For example, a machine with multiple polishing heads can polish multiple diamonds at the same time, significantly increasing production output but also increasing the price. The level of automation also plays a major role; more automated machines reduce labor costs but increase the initial investment. The precision of the machine is important for achieving high-quality polishing and is often reflected in the price. The materials used can also affect the overall cost, with high-quality components contributing to greater durability and precision.
Cutting Machines
Cutting machines are used to shape rough diamonds into the forms we see in jewelry. These machines are a critical part of the diamond manufacturing process. Diamond cutting machines are generally more expensive than polishing machines due to their complex mechanisms and the high precision required. Expect to pay anywhere from $10,000 to well over $200,000 depending on the size, precision, and automation level. Smaller, manual cutting machines might be available at the lower end of the price range. Larger, more automated cutting machines, especially those used for large-scale production, can be significantly pricier. The price depends on factors like the type of cutting (laser, saw, etc.), the level of automation (manual, semi-automatic, fully automatic), the precision of the cutting, and the machine's overall capacity. Laser cutting machines, for instance, are often more expensive than traditional saw-based machines, but offer greater precision and reduced material waste. Automated cutting machines can significantly increase efficiency and reduce labor costs, but also command a higher initial investment. The capacity of the machine to handle various diamond sizes also influences the price, as machines capable of handling larger diamonds are typically more expensive. The features of the machine, such as advanced control systems and safety features, further affect the cost.
Laser Machines
Laser machines play a unique role in the diamond industry. They're used for a variety of tasks, from cutting and shaping to inscription and internal flaw removal. Laser technology offers incredible precision, but it comes at a premium. The price range for laser machines can vary widely, starting from around $20,000 and going all the way up to $300,000 or more. The type of laser (e.g., CO2, fiber) and its power output will significantly affect the price. Higher-powered lasers are capable of cutting through harder materials and performing complex tasks faster, but they come at a higher cost. Automation features, such as robotic arms and automated control systems, will further increase the price. Furthermore, the software and control systems that operate the laser machines also influence the overall cost. The laser's precision is critical in diamond processing. Machines offering greater precision are more expensive. This precision ensures that the diamond is cut or processed with high accuracy, leading to better quality results. The features included also affect the price; advanced safety features, user-friendly interfaces, and maintenance requirements also add to the cost. The machine's build quality and durability can also influence the cost, as machines designed to withstand high-volume use are typically made from higher-quality components, thereby increasing their price.
Factors That Influence Diamond Machine Prices
Okay, so we've covered the basics of different machine types. Now, let's look at the factors that significantly impact the price of these machines. Understanding these elements can help you make a more informed purchasing decision.
Machine Size and Capacity
Size matters, guys! The larger the machine and the more diamonds it can process at once, the more it's likely to cost. Machines designed for high-volume production have larger capacities and advanced features, resulting in higher prices. The capacity of a diamond machine dictates how many diamonds it can process in a given period. This is often measured by the size of the work area, the number of diamond holders, and the speed of the machine. Machines designed for processing a large volume of diamonds are generally more expensive due to their complex designs and advanced technology. The larger the machine, the more materials and labor are required in its construction, which increases the price. The physical size of the machine also affects the cost, as larger machines require more space for installation, which may involve additional costs for infrastructure modification. For example, a polishing machine designed to handle a large number of small diamonds simultaneously will be more expensive than one designed for a single diamond. The size of a machine can also affect its ability to handle different shapes and sizes of diamonds, which further influences the price. The capacity of the machine is important to consider in relation to your diamond production needs, as a machine that exceeds your needs may result in an unnecessary investment.
Automation Level
Automation is the name of the game in modern diamond manufacturing. Highly automated machines, which reduce the need for manual labor and increase efficiency, generally come with a higher price tag. Machines with features such as robotic arms, automated loading and unloading systems, and computer-controlled polishing processes are more expensive due to their complex designs and advanced technology. The level of automation impacts both the initial cost and the long-term operational costs. While automated machines have a higher initial investment, they can significantly reduce labor costs and increase production efficiency over time. The sophistication of the automation systems directly affects the price. Features such as advanced sensors, precision controls, and integrated software contribute to the machine's cost. The automation level of a machine also determines its operational complexity. A highly automated machine may require specialized training for operators and technicians, adding to the overall cost. Machines with semi-automated features often provide a balance between the initial investment and the operational benefits. The more automated a machine is, the greater its potential for reducing human error and increasing the consistency of the diamond polishing and cutting processes.
Precision and Technology
Precision is key in the diamond industry. Machines offering higher precision, utilizing advanced technologies like laser cutting or sophisticated polishing techniques, come at a premium. The technologies used in diamond machines have a significant impact on their prices. Cutting-edge technologies, such as laser cutting, offer greater precision and efficiency but require a higher initial investment. The precision of a machine is directly linked to the quality of the diamond processing. High-precision machines ensure that diamonds are cut and polished with minimal errors, resulting in higher-quality results. Precision is often measured by the machine's ability to maintain tight tolerances and achieve a high degree of accuracy. The use of advanced software and control systems contributes to the overall precision of the machine. The algorithms used to control the machine's movements, polishing, and cutting processes are complex and often proprietary, increasing the cost. The quality of components used in the machine also influences precision. High-quality components, such as precision bearings, motors, and sensors, contribute to greater accuracy and durability. The machine’s precision directly affects the quality and value of the finished diamonds. Therefore, the higher the precision, the better the quality and value. Features such as optical sensors, computerized controls, and real-time monitoring systems also influence the cost.
Brand and Manufacturer
Just like with any product, the brand and manufacturer play a significant role in pricing. Well-known, reputable brands often command higher prices due to their reputation for quality, reliability, and customer service. Brands with a strong reputation for producing high-quality machines often have higher prices. Their reputation reflects their reliability, performance, and customer support. The manufacturer's location can also influence the price, as labor costs, manufacturing processes, and import/export duties can vary. The availability of after-sales service and support can affect the price, as established brands often provide better customer service and maintenance options. The presence of a warranty and its terms also affect the price, as it reflects the manufacturer's confidence in the product's durability and performance. The brand's reputation for innovation and technological advancements also plays a role in pricing, as companies investing in R&D often have higher prices to reflect their expertise. When purchasing a machine, it's crucial to assess the brand's reputation, customer reviews, and the quality of their products.
Finding the Best Deals on Diamond Machines
Okay, so you've got a handle on the costs. Now, how do you find the best deals? Here are some tips and tricks to help you save some money without sacrificing quality.
Research and Compare Prices
Do your homework, guys! Compare prices from different suppliers and manufacturers. Don't settle for the first quote you get. The Internet is a great tool for this, allowing you to browse different models, read reviews, and compare prices.
Consider Used Machines
Used machines can be a cost-effective option, especially if you're just starting out. Make sure to thoroughly inspect the machine and check its maintenance records before purchasing.
Negotiate and Ask for Discounts
Don't be afraid to negotiate, especially if you're buying multiple machines or making a large purchase. Ask about any available discounts or financing options.
Attend Industry Trade Shows
Trade shows are a great place to see the latest machines in action and often offer special deals and discounts.
Check for Financing Options
Many manufacturers offer financing options or partner with financial institutions to make purchasing easier. Explore these options to ease the financial burden.
